The most common culprit in this part of the Mid-Cities is not the operator motor. It’s the Fort Worth Clay underneath the post, swelling and shrinking with the wet-dry cycle until a 40-year-old swing gate leans out of plumb and drags the driveway. That repeated sag is a soil problem wearing a hinge disguise. The fix is not another shim. It’s resetting the post footing below the shrink-swell zone, in concrete designed for North Texas clay. Electric Gate Repair

Electric gate repair in Bedford typically runs $195 to $520, depending on whether the fault is in the operator, the wiring, the safety photocells, or the keypad. Bedford’s original 1970s-90s operators were often sized for the gate as built, not the gate as it sits now with a decade of added weight from rust, water, and improvised shims. The motor burns out trying to move a gate it was never meant to lift. We diagnose the full circuit, not just the symptom, and most Bedford electric gate repairs are finished the same day.

Automatic Gate Repair

Automatic gate repair in Bedford ranges from $225 for a straightforward limit-switch adjustment to $640 for a slide gate off its rack from a spring hailstorm. Bedford sits squarely in the DFW hail belt, and we regularly see aluminum gate panels dented and lighter automated arms bent after March and April storms. The damage may be cosmetic at first, but a bent arm binds the travel, trips the safety photocells, and burns out the operator. We repair the automation and the metal, often in one visit.

Hinge & Post Repair

This is the work that keeps a Bedford gate square for a decade instead of two years. Hinge and post repair in Bedford runs $310 to $780, and the price reflects whether we’re re-welding a hinge plate or digging out an old footing and pouring a new one. The Fort Worth Clay under Bedford shrinks hard in July and August drought, and swells again after heavy spring rain. Posts move. Hinges bind. Gates drag on the driveway corner and leave a thumb-wide gap at the latch side. The only lasting fix is footing depth and concrete that accounts for that movement.

Gate Realignment

Gate realignment in Bedford typically costs $185 to $350 when the posts and hinges are still sound and the gate simply needs to be re-squared and re-tensioned. But we’re honest with Bedford homeowners: if the post has heaved, realignment alone is a temporary patch. We’ll tell you plainly whether the footer needs resetting before we adjust anything. A square gate on a moving post will not stay square, no matter how many times you re-hang it.

Common Gate Repair Problems We See in Bedford Homes

  • Clay-soil post heave. Bedford’s Fort Worth Clay shrinks so aggressively in summer drought that swing gate posts on 30-50-year-old installations heave out of plumb. The gate drags one corner and gaps at the latch, and the problem returns every two to three years unless the post footing is excavated and reset with concrete designed for shrink-swell movement.
  • Undersized, overworked operators. Original 1970s-90s LiftMaster and Linear operators were matched to gates that weighed far less before decades of rust, water, and amateur shims. The motor strains, the chain or belt slackens, and the operator burns out years before it should.
  • Hail damage to panels and arms. Spring hailstorms in the DFW belt dent aluminum gate panels and bend lighter automated gate arms. A bent arm on a slide gate knocks it off the rack and pinion track, and the safety photocells start throwing false trips that reverse the gate halfway.
  • Rotted cedar posts and rusted bottom rails. Bedford’s original wood privacy gates from the 1970s and 1980s have cedar posts below grade that are decades past their service life. Rusted bottom rails on ornamental iron gates are almost universal, and we cut out and weld in fresh steel rather than painting over active corrosion.

We reset the hinge post on a 1980s ornamental iron swing gate off Pipeline Road that had been re-hung twice in six years but never had its original concrete footer excavated. Our crew drilled down past the shrink-swell zone, poured a wider, deeper post footing, and realigned the gate so it cleared the driveway with a consistent reveal. No more sag correction needed since.

Pricing for Gate Repair in Bedford, TX

Gate repair in Bedford runs from about $185 for a minor realignment or latch adjustment up to $780 for a full post footing replacement with a heavier hinge system. Electric gate repairs land between $195 and $520. Automatic gate repairs range from $225 to $640. A complete operator replacement on a Bedford driveway gate, including the motor, receiver, and safety edges, typically runs $1,100 to $2,400 installed, depending on gate weight and brand.
